NUMERATOR TO LAUNCH NEW INFLATION DATA ON NOVEMBER 13
Comprehensive Approach Captures Both Price Changes and How Consumers Adapt Their Shopping, While Closely Tracking U.S. Government Inflation Measures
CHICAGO, Nov. 12,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Numerator, a data and technology company providing insights into consumer behavior, will introduce a new, consumer-centric measure of inflation powered by its verified, item-level retail purchase data. Similar to the U.S. Bureau of Economic Analysis’ published indexes, this measure tracks price changes over time and captures how consumer buying behavior evolves alongside them.
An advance metric will be released on Thursday, November 13 at 8:30 a.m. ET, providing financial institutions, policymakers, and economists visibility into inflation trends across everyday consumer goods. The data cover approximately 20% of the consumption basket captured in the government’s Consumer Price Index (CPI) and Personal Consumption Expenditures (PCE) index, offering a reliable signal of retail price changes experienced by U.S. consumers.
Thursday’s data release will include:
- Month-over-month inflation change through October 2025
- Year-over-year inflation change through October 2025
- Cumulative inflation index since 2018
- Expenditure and product shares by sector covered in Numerator’s Consumer Price Index (CPI)
Numerator’s measure provides a comprehensive view of inflation by:
- Capturing how consumers adjust their shopping when prices change, including brand switching, downsizing, and shifts in where they buy.
- Using verified household purchase data from the demand side, providing visibility into consumer behavior.
- Drawing on item-level transactions from 200,000 geographically and demographically representative U.S. households, covering categories such as groceries, household goods, and health and beauty.
- Delivering a current view of inflation trends, with continuously captured household purchase data aggregated monthly.
